ABOUT W EDINBURGH KITCHEN: W Edinburgh brings exciting new culinary destinations to the capital of Scotland. Our signature restaurant is a partnership with SUSHISAMBA, which celebrates the culture and cuisine of Japan, Brazil and Peru. The menus are a mix of new and signature dishes with an emphasis on bold flavours, the finest ingredients and artful presentations.

ABOUT THE ROLE: Joining the team means you will be instrumental to the success of the hotel and the restaurants. We are looking for someone who is passionate about cooking, eager to learn and committed to excellence! As Demi Chef de Partie, key aspects of your role will include:

  • Prepare all potentially hazardous foods at the correct temperature according to the HACCP guidelines.
  • Follow appropriate personal hygiene procedures to ensure food served to guests is safe for consumption.
  • Ensure compliance with food safety and handling policies and procedures.
  • Monitor the quality of the food items and notify manager if a product does not meet specifications.
  • Control food waste and ensure that good food is not thrown away.
  • Communicate any assistance needed during busy periods to the Chef.
  • Operate ovens, stoves, grills, microwaves, and fryers to prepare foods.
  • Check and ensure the correctness of the temperature of appliances and food.
  • Report maintenance issues immediately to appropriate personnel.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of company Food Safety Programs.

W Edinburgh brings bold architecture and a vibrant lifestyle offering to the Scottish capital. This W hotel helps redefine the city’s hospitality landscape. Built in 2023, this new W hotel accommodates guests across 244 stylish guestrooms, including 45 suites.
